Add quick-add feature with improved workflows (#802)

* Changes from feature/quick-add

* feat: Clarify system prompt and improve error handling across services. Address PR Feedback

* feat: Improve PR description parsing and refactor event handling

* feat: Add context options to pipeline orchestrator initialization

* fix: Deduplicate React and handle CJS interop for use-sync-external-store

Resolve "Cannot read properties of null (reading 'useState')" errors by
deduplicating React/react-dom and ensuring use-sync-external-store is
bundled together with React to prevent CJS packages from resolving to
different React instances.
